LAKE CHEROKEE  Quick Facts

 Orlando's Lakes

South of Osceola Avenue and Palmer Street intersection.    Neighborhood Map (pdf)

Lake Surface Area: 13 acres                                          Mean Depth: 8 ft. 6 in.

Lake Volume: 35,965,600  gal                                        Aeration:  NO  

Shoreline Length: 2,980 ft.                                              Lake Origin:  Natural

Predominate Drainage Basin Land Use: Residential (40%) Commercial (7%) Vacant (27%)

LAKEWATCH: YES                                                     

Park:  YES                                                                     Lake Cherokee Park 

Fishing:  YES                                                                 Fishing in Orlando

Boat Ramp:  NO 

2003 WATER QUALITY REPORT                                    Quick Summary                          

AVERAGE SECCHI DEPTH                                             3 ft. 3 in.

(an indication of water clarity)

 

AVERAGE TROPHIC STATE INDEX                                  58

(water quality indicator) 

 

TROPHIC STATE                                                             Mesotrophic                                   

(describes level of biological productivity)

 

2003 Trophic State Index Ranking: 58 (out of 93 Lakes)

 

2002 Trophic State Index Ranking: 51 (out of 93 Lakes)

 

2001 Trophic State Index Ranking: 78 (out of 91 Lakes)

 

2000 Trophic State Index Ranking: 75 (out of 94 Lakes)

Comments:  Receives overflow from Lake Lucerne, which is treated with alum.  Discharges to Lake Davis.  Experienced severe algae blooms during 2001, which was probably related to decreased flushing from upstream lakes due to drought conditions.
